What is an Orthodontic Aligner Design Service?
An orthodontic aligner design service provides expert digital planning and virtual setup of clear aligner cases for dental labs, orthodontists, and DSOs. This service involves taking digital impressions or intraoral scans, patient photos, and a doctor’s prescription, then using advanced CAD software to create a precise 3D model of the patient’s teeth and meticulously plan the entire sequence of tooth movements required to achieve the desired final occlusion.
Our comprehensive orthodontic aligner design service encompasses every critical step of the digital aligner workflow. From the initial virtual segmentation of teeth to the precise staging of movements, attachment placement, IPR (interproximal reduction) planning, and the generation of virtual models for each aligner stage, our skilled designers leverage cutting-edge software like 3Shape Ortho Analyzer and Exocad to ensure optimal results. This detailed planning not only ensures predictable tooth movement but also provides the necessary STL files for 3D printing of aligner models, ready for thermoforming. The Digital Workflow: How Our Orthodontic Aligner Design Service Works
Our process is designed for seamless integration into your existing workflow, making it incredibly easy to leverage our orthodontic aligner design service:
- Case Submission: You begin by submitting digital impressions (e.g., from Medit i500/i700, Dentsply Sirona Primescan, or 3Shape TRIOS), traditional PVS impressions (which we can scan), patient photos, and your detailed prescription. Our secure online portal ensures a confidential and efficient submission process.
- Treatment Planning and Virtual Setup: Our expert designers review your submission thoroughly. We then use advanced CAD software to segment teeth, analyze the occlusion, and meticulously plan the desired tooth movements. This involves creating a virtual setup of the final desired position and then staging the intermediate movements, typically in increments of 0.2-0.25mm per aligner. Attachments and IPR are strategically planned to facilitate these movements.
- Design Review and Approval: Once the initial design and treatment plan are complete, we send you a comprehensive virtual representation of the proposed aligner series. This includes a 3D animation of the tooth movements, showing each stage from the initial position to the final desired outcome. You and your prescribing doctor can review, request modifications, and approve the plan. This collaborative approach ensures the final design aligns perfectly with your clinical objectives.
- Delivery of STL Files: Upon approval, we generate and securely deliver the STL files for each aligner stage. These files are optimized for 3D printing, allowing your lab to efficiently produce the physical aligner models.
- Manufacturing Integration: With the STL files in hand, your lab can proceed directly to 3D printing the models and thermoforming the aligners. Our designs are compatible with standard manufacturing processes, ensuring a smooth transition from design to final product.
